A regional business organization based in Birmingham is seeking an Events & Marketing Executive to support the planning and execution of various member events. This exciting role involves creating marketing campaigns, coordinating event logistics, and ensuring a fantastic member experience.
The ideal candidate will have:
- A passion for marketing and events
- Experience in social media
- Strong organizational skills
This position offers a vibrant work environment with flexibility for some evening and early morning events.

How to prepare for a job interview at Greater Birmingham Chambers of Commerce
✨Know Your Events Inside Out
Before the interview, research the types of events the organisation has hosted in the past. Familiarise yourself with their marketing strategies and member engagement tactics. This will show your genuine interest and help you discuss how your skills can enhance their future events.
✨Showcase Your Marketing Savvy
Prepare examples of successful marketing campaigns you've worked on, especially those related to events. Be ready to discuss your approach to social media and how it can be leveraged to promote events effectively. This will demonstrate your practical experience and creativity.
✨Organisational Skills are Key
Highlight your organisational skills by discussing specific tools or methods you use to manage multiple tasks. Whether it's event planning software or a simple checklist, showing that you have a system in place will reassure them of your ability to handle logistics smoothly.
✨Be Ready for Flexibility Questions
Since the role involves evening and early morning events, be prepared to discuss your availability and willingness to adapt. Share any previous experiences where you successfully managed your time around similar commitments, showcasing your flexibility and dedication.
